news 2026/4/20 9:13:53

终极指南:5分钟掌握TensorBoard专业配色技巧

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
终极指南:5分钟掌握TensorBoard专业配色技巧

终极指南:5分钟掌握TensorBoard专业配色技巧

【免费下载链接】tensorboardTensorFlow's Visualization Toolkit项目地址: https://gitcode.com/gh_mirrors/te/tensorboard

还在为TensorBoard中混乱的彩虹色曲线而困扰吗?当多个实验曲线交织在一起,重要的数据洞察往往被糟糕的配色所淹没。本文为你带来简单易行的TensorBoard配色优化方案,让可视化效果瞬间提升专业水准。

快速入门:一键切换配色方案

TensorBoard内置了多种专业配色方案,无需编写任何代码即可快速切换。在项目核心配置文件tensorboard/components/tf_color_scale/palettes.ts中,你可以找到这些精心设计的调色板:

新手推荐方案

  • googleStandard:基础谷歌色系,包含9种经典颜色
  • googleCool:冷色调方案,适合科技感强的展示
  • googleWarm:暖色调组合,强调趋势变化

图:使用默认配色的标量数据可视化,清晰的曲线对比效果

3步实现个性化配色

第一步:了解配色原理

TensorBoard的配色系统基于智能映射机制,自动为不同的训练运行分配专属颜色。当你有新的实验运行时,系统会循环使用调色板中的颜色,确保每个曲线都有良好的视觉区分度。

第二步:选择适合场景的配色

不同场景需要不同的配色策略:

  • 少量实验对比(<5组):推荐使用googleStandard,颜色丰富且对比明显
  • 学术论文展示:选择tensorboardColorBlindAssist,符合国际色盲友好标准
  • 团队协作场景:使用googleCool或googleWarm建立统一的视觉规范

第三步:应用配色效果

图:多标量对比实验,展示不同学习率和损失的时间序列

实用配色技巧大公开

技巧一:避免颜色疲劳

当曲线数量较多时,避免使用高饱和度颜色。推荐使用中等饱和度的色彩组合,既能保证区分度,又不会造成视觉疲劳。

技巧二:建立语义映射

为不同类型的实验建立一致的颜色语义:

  • 红色系:基线模型或标准配置
  • 蓝色系:优化版本或改进方案
  • 绿色系:实验性尝试或新方法验证

技巧三:打印兼容性

确保配色方案在黑白打印时仍能保持清晰区分。测试方法:将可视化截图转换为灰度模式,检查曲线是否依然可辨识。

专业配色方案深度解析

色盲友好设计

TensorBoard的tensorboardColorBlindAssist调色板经过了专业色彩理论验证,确保红绿色盲用户也能准确读取数据。

图:使用语义化配色的超参数平行坐标图,通过颜色传递数值信息

行业专用配色

根据不同行业特点,可以定制专属配色方案:

  • 医疗领域:使用温和的蓝色、绿色系,避免刺激性红色
  • 金融分析:采用稳重的深蓝、灰色调,体现专业严谨
  • 教育科研:选择对比明显的色彩组合,便于课堂展示

进阶应用与团队协作

配色方案标准化

在团队项目中,建立统一的配色规范能够显著提升协作效率:

  1. 定义颜色语义:明确每种颜色的使用场景
  2. 创建调色板文档:记录配色方案的使用规则
  • 文档位置:docs/design/
  • 配置说明:tensorboard/components/tf_color_scale/

持续优化策略

定期回顾配色效果,根据实际使用反馈进行调整:

  • 用户反馈收集:询问团队成员对当前配色的感受
  • 使用场景适配:根据不同项目需求微调配色方案

效果对比与最佳实践

前后对比展示

通过合理的配色优化,TensorBoard的可视化效果将发生质的飞跃:

  • 信息传达更清晰:重要数据点一目了然
  • 视觉体验更舒适:长时间查看不易疲劳
  • 专业形象更突出:展示给客户或上级时更具说服力

图:TensorBoard文本展示功能,简洁的配色专注于内容呈现

总结与行动指南

掌握TensorBoard配色优化的核心要点:

  1. 从内置方案开始:无需复杂配置,一键切换专业配色
  2. 遵循基本原则:对比度、语义映射、兼容性
  3. 持续迭代优化:根据实际使用效果不断调整

立即行动

  • 打开你的TensorBoard项目
  • 尝试切换不同的配色方案
  • 感受专业配色带来的可视化提升

通过本文介绍的简单方法,即使是机器学习新手也能快速提升TensorBoard的可视化专业水准。记住,好的配色不仅美观,更重要的是能够有效传达数据洞察。

进阶学习路径

想要深入学习TensorBoard配色定制?建议按以下路径:

  1. 基础掌握:熟悉本文介绍的快速配色方法
  2. 实践应用:在真实项目中尝试不同配色方案
  3. 团队推广:将成功经验分享给团队成员

TensorBoard的配色优化是一个持续的过程,随着项目经验的积累,你会逐渐形成自己的配色风格。现在就开始实践,让你的数据可视化效果迈上新台阶!

【免费下载链接】tensorboardTensorFlow's Visualization Toolkit项目地址: https://gitcode.com/gh_mirrors/te/tensorboard

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/19 15:36:52

39、编程与开发相关知识及环境搭建与许可协议解读

编程与开发相关知识及环境搭建与许可协议解读 编程术语解释 在编程领域,有许多重要的术语和概念,下面为大家详细介绍一些常见的术语。 - SVG :一种基于 XML 文档类型的开放标准矢量图形格式,常用于创建可缩放的图形。 - 同步(synchronous) :使用同步 I/O 操作的程…

作者头像 李华
网站建设 2026/4/18 7:02:06

23、Ubuntu相关工具与社区介绍

Ubuntu相关工具与社区介绍 在Ubuntu的生态系统中,有众多实用的工具和活跃的社区。下面为你详细介绍这些内容。 一、Launchpad相关工具 Launchpad Blueprint Tracker(蓝图跟踪器) - 功能概述 :这是Ubuntu自定义的规范和特性跟踪系统。用户能创建规范页面,并链接到现…

作者头像 李华
网站建设 2026/4/18 10:07:47

MySQL内置函数

1. 日期函数函数名称描述current_date()当前日期current_time()当前时间current_timestamp()当前时间戳date(datetime)返回 datetime 参数的日期部分date_add(date, interval d_value_type)在 date 中添加日期或时间interval 后的数值单位可以是&#xff1a;year minute second…

作者头像 李华
网站建设 2026/4/18 4:00:47

11fps实时视频生成革命:Krea Realtime 14B如何重塑内容创作范式

11fps实时视频生成革命&#xff1a;Krea Realtime 14B如何重塑内容创作范式 【免费下载链接】krea-realtime-video 项目地址: https://ai.gitcode.com/hf_mirrors/krea/krea-realtime-video 导语 2025年10月&#xff0c;Krea AI发布的Realtime 14B模型标志着实时视频生…

作者头像 李华
网站建设 2026/4/17 13:49:38

NocoDB数据导出实战指南:5分钟掌握CSV/JSON双格式导出技巧

NocoDB数据导出实战指南&#xff1a;5分钟掌握CSV/JSON双格式导出技巧 【免费下载链接】nocodb nocodb/nocodb: 是一个基于 node.js 和 SQLite 数据库的开源 NoSQL 数据库&#xff0c;它提供了可视化的 Web 界面用于管理和操作数据库。适合用于构建简单的 NoSQL 数据库&#xf…

作者头像 李华